Output e3f566667bdf3b63cfbb4c5a2d99f16881f8751f6a29adc411b131c2fd9666f1:1

value
1595778
script pubkey
OP_0 OP_PUSHBYTES_20 5433604150c31db4a0cb4f37d51ee6d4362e52ac
address
ltc1q2sekqs2scvwmfgxtfuma28hx6smzu54vy7a09g
transaction
e3f566667bdf3b63cfbb4c5a2d99f16881f8751f6a29adc411b131c2fd9666f1
spent
true